This specific version introduced improvements in query execution plans, enhanced support for the SQL Graph architecture, and better integration with Azure SQL Database. By downloading and installing this tool, an administrator or developer gains the ability to deploy, monitor, and upgrade data-tier components, write and debug Transact-SQL scripts, and manage server security—all from a unified graphical interface. It transforms the abstract database engine into a tangible, manageable asset.

Once downloaded and launched, the installation process is largely automated, but key decisions remain. Users can choose between a “default” installation path or a custom location. For most administrators, the default path is acceptable, though organizations with strict software deployment policies may opt for a custom directory. The installer handles all dependencies, including Visual Studio 2015 Isolated Shell components, and provides a progress bar indicating the extraction and configuration of features. Bridging this gap for Microsoft’s flagship database product is SQL Server Management Studio (SSMS). While numerous versions of SSMS have been released, the 2017 iteration stands as a significant milestone, representing a shift toward a more agile, decoupled release cycle.
